Working Principle:
It usually adopts an electrochemical sensing principle. The oxygen
in the measured gas diffuses into the sensor through the diffusion
layer and reacts at the working electrode, generating an electric
current proportional to the oxygen concentration. This current
signal is processed by the internal circuit of the sensor to obtain
the oxygen concentration value.

Target Gas | Oxygen (O₂) |
Measuring Range | 0% - 100% VOL (O₂) |
Measurement Accuracy | ±1% Full Scale (F.S.) |
Response Time (T90) | ≤ 20 seconds (under standard conditions: 25℃, 1 atmospheric
pressure, 50% RH) |
Operating Temperature Range | -20℃ ~ +60℃ |
Operating Humidity Range | 15% ~ 90% RH (non-condensing; typical industrial/environmental
humidity adaptability) |
Operating Pressure Range | 86 kPa ~ 106 kPa (atmospheric pressure ±10%) |
Output Signal | Analog signal (e.g., 4 - 20 mA DC / 0 - 5 V DC; optimized for
medical equipment signal integration) |
Power Supply | 12 - 24 V DC (compatible with common medical device power systems) |
Sensor Lifetime | ≥ 2 years (under normal medical use conditions: clean air, stable
temperature/humidity) |
Zero Drift | ≤ ±0.3% F.S. per year (in clean air at 25℃; ensures long-term
measurement stability) |
Sensitivity Drift | ≤ ±1.5% F.S. per year (in clean air at 25℃; minimizes calibration
frequency) |
Protection Rating | IP65 (dust-tight and protected against low-pressure water jets,
suitable for medical environments) |
Compatibility | Designed for integration with medical devices (anesthesia machines,
ventilators, oxygen monitors) |
Calibration Requirement | Factory pre-calibrated; recommended re-calibration every 6 - 12
months for medical use |
Physical Dimensions (Typical) | Customized for medical device installation (e.g., 30 mm × 25 mm ×
15 mm; subject to actual model) |
